Internship/ Project Description:
With engineer’s guidance to perform, collect data and analyze on unusually complex experiments to develop the complicated physical vapor deposition (PVD) product
Job scope including:
a) PVD process optimization & measure metal film properties, organize data/reports for review;
b) Perform hardware characterization on moderately difficult systems, within safety guidelines;
c) With engineer’s guidance, involve in troubleshooting moderately complex problems, perform Root Cause Analysis and resolve moderately difficult process engineering issues
Learning Outcome:
- Learn about the semiconductor industry and its forefront PVD technology
- Appreciate the complexity of PVD technology and have hands-on experience in using the tools
- Able to think critically and come up with creative solutions
- Able to discuss findings and articulate ideas confidently
